    Sony KDL-60EX500 Backlight Error / 6 Blinks

    Good Sunday morning everyone.

    I have the TV listed above in hand which was given to me for free after a lightning strike took it out along with several other items in a friends house. Upon plugging it in and pressing the power button, the startup tone plays followed by an immediate shutdown with the 6 blink error. I downloaded the service manual and 6 blinks = backlight issue. This seems logical since the backlights don't even flash when the TV attempts to power up.

    Next step, removed the back and checked voltages. Main board is sending the POW-ON and BL-ON signals. Flashlight test shows the Sony Logo when It tries to start. Power Supply has 12V present but no 24V.

    Removed supply from TV to bench test. Fed 3V from the standby pin into POW-ON and BL-ON (I had previously confirmed the main board was sending these signals so I assumed I would get the same result). Confirmed that the 24V rail does not come up even for a second. 12V rail is steady at 12.14V actual output. Main filter cap is steady at 392V when POW-ON is applied and is 165V without POW-ON.

    I've attached pictures of just the power supply since I already have the problem narrowed down. I'm quite efficient at component level repair but haven't worked on this particular board. Replacements are scarce. I do see one person on Ebay offering repair service for $65 but I'd prefer to do it myself if possible. As always, any opinions are greatly appreciated.

    I think the 24V supply is a single supply being supplied via diode RC601,2,3 & 4 rectifying the output of transformer T301. T301 looks to be driven by Q301, Q302 again they are being switched by the IC behind the heatsink, number unknown.

                          Just to update on this but after weighing my options and the fact that replacement power supplies for this are basically non-existent, I decided to send off the board to PTS Board Repair for $58 including return shipping. It appears that the controller chip was not replaced but a handful of other components around it were. The TV is now fully functional and I've already sold it. Given the fact that it was free to begin with that was a heck of a deal.
